University of West Georgia (UWG) is committed to fostering a culture of transparency and accountability. The purpose of the UWG Ethics & Compliance Reporting Hotline is to provide a confidential reporting process for suspected fraud, waste and abuse or other policy and ethics violations.

STEP 1: Are you an employee? (If not an employee, please go to STEP 2)

If an employee (student employees included), can you report your concerns to your immediate supervisor?

UWG employees are encouraged, when appropriate, to first raise workplace concerns with their immediate supervisor. We recognize, however, that this may not always be possible or appropriate given the circumstances. If you are unable to report your concern to your supervisor, please continue reviewing the options and next steps outlined below.

STEP 2: Review reporting processes based on your concerns.

Please review the options below for further guidance on how to report your concerns:

Personnel & Employee Relations Concerns (i.e. Retaliation, Harassment, Unfair Employment Practices, etc.), please visit the Office of Human Resources webpage for resources and contact information at https://workwest.westga.edu/hr/employee-relations.php.
